WebIf your estate includes a family home which is passing on to direct descendants, you can claim the Residence Nil Rate Band. This is up to £175,000 per individual, (£350,000 for a couple passing on a jointly owned property), capped at the value of the property. Giving away the property means missing out on this relief.
